Påmeldingslista er oppe å går

This commit is contained in:
Trygve 2025-10-24 18:59:46 +02:00
parent 8d3b914433
commit d408d18de5
2 changed files with 9 additions and 7 deletions

View File

@ -17,16 +17,18 @@
<body> <body>
<div class="flex align-center"> <div class="flex align-center">
<figure><img src="img/kadaver.png" alt="" width="100px" class="invert"></figure> <figure><img src="img/kadaver.png" alt="" width="100px" class="invert"></figure>
<h1>Påmeldte Kadaverløpet 2024</h1> <h1>Påmeldte Kadaverløpet 2025</h1>
</div> </div>
<h2>Oppdatert 1.11.24</h2> <h2>Oppdatert 24.10.25</h2>
<div class="flash attention">Startnummer blir tildelt nærmere arrangementet. Prøver å oppdatere lsita gjevnlig. TBN</div>
<?php <?php
$query = ["type"=>"paameldte"]; $query = ["type"=>"paameldte"];
include("table.php"); include("table.php");
participants_table($runners);
?> ?>
<footer> <footer>
<h3>Laget av Trygve. <a href="https://git.willy.club/Trygve/elektronisk-kadaver-tidtakingssystem">Kildekode</a></h3> <h3>Laget av Trygve. <a href="https://git.willy.club/Trygve/elektronisk-kadaver-tidtakingssystem">Kildekode</a></h3>
<figure><img src="img/NMBUI.webp" alt="" width="200px"></figure> <figure><img src="img/NMBUI.webp" alt="" width="200px"></figure>
</footer> </footer>
</body> </body>
</html> </html>

View File

@ -110,10 +110,9 @@ function time_diff(DateTime $date_1, DateTime $date_2) {
$runners = []; $runners = [];
$csv_runners = file_get_contents("db.csv"); $csv_runners = file_get_contents("db.csv");
$csv_runners = str_getcsv($csv_runners, "\n"); $csv_runners = str_getcsv($csv_runners, "\n");
//print_r($csv_runners);
for ($i = 1; $i < count($csv_runners); $i++) { for ($i = 1; $i < count($csv_runners); $i++) {
$line = str_getcsv($csv_runners[$i]); $line = str_getcsv($csv_runners[$i], ";");
array_push($runners, new Runner($line[0], $line[1], $line[2], $line[3])); array_push($runners, new Runner($line[0], $line[2], $line[5], $line[6]));
} }
@ -245,6 +244,7 @@ function liveresult_table($runners) {
for ($i = 0; $i < count($runners); $i++) { for ($i = 0; $i < count($runners); $i++) {
$runner = $runners[$i]; $runner = $runners[$i];
$tid_maal = ""; $tid_maal = "";
$sprekk = "<td></td>";
if ($runner->splits[2] != false) { if ($runner->splits[2] != false) {
$tid_maal = $GLOBALS['start_time']->diff($runner->splits[2])->format('%H:%I:%S'); $tid_maal = $GLOBALS['start_time']->diff($runner->splits[2])->format('%H:%I:%S');
} }
@ -288,7 +288,7 @@ function liveresult_table($runners) {
} }
if (!isset($query)){ if (!isset($query)){
parse_str($_SERVER['QUERY_STRING'], $query); //parse_str($_SERVER['QUERY_STRING'], $query);
if ($query["type"] == "registrering"){ if ($query["type"] == "registrering"){
registration_table($runners); registration_table($runners);
} }